Meanings and Origins of the name Ruth

The name Ruth originates from the Hebrew word "Re'ut," meaning "friend" or "companion." It carries significant biblical ties, most notably through the Book of Ruth in the Old Testament, where Ruth is portrayed as a figure of loyalty and dedication. This deep-rooted history imbues the name with layers of meaning, creating a rich backdrop for any pet bearing it.

In many languages and cultures, Ruth is synonymous with friendship and loyalty. This makes it especially poignant for pets, who often embody these very traits in their relationship with their owners. Whether it’s a dog that remains a faithful friend through thick and thin or a cat that shares a quiet understanding with its human, the name Ruth underlines these qualities.
